- Krampus (Krampus, 2015): Krampus, the anti-Santa, embodies the punishment aspect of the Christmas custom. His motivation stems from a want to punish those that have misplaced their Christmas spirit. He seems as a horned, demonic determine, usually accompanied by equally monstrous helpers like gingerbread males and demonic elves. His interactions with the setting are direct; he emerges from the snowy panorama, turning festive decorations like Christmas lights and ornaments into traps and instruments of terror.
He represents the consequence of not believing within the magic of Christmas, or extra precisely, within the values the vacation represents. The movie leverages the folklore of Krampus, an historical European determine, to subvert the expectation of Santa Claus and the enjoyment of the vacation.
- Billy Chapman (Silent Night time, Lethal Night time, 1984): Billy Chapman is pushed by trauma stemming from witnessing the homicide of his dad and mom on Christmas Eve. He’s a twisted determine, dressed as Santa Claus, whose actions are a perversion of the vacation’s giving spirit. His look, the Santa go well with, turns into a disguise for his murderous intent. He stalks his victims, usually focusing on these he perceives as “naughty,” mirroring the judgmental facet of the vacation.
His lair, or moderately the areas the place he commits his crimes, are infused with Christmas decorations, just like the brightly lit tree in a darkened room, which distinction sharply with the acts of violence. Billy’s motivation is rooted in revenge and a distorted sense of justice, a direct response to the perceived injustice of his personal Christmas expertise.
- Garland (Black Christmas, 1974 & 2006): Garland, the unseen killer, (or killers in several variations) in Black Christmas preys on sorority sisters throughout their Christmas break. Whereas the precise motivation varies, it normally entails a deep-seated hatred or a want for management over his victims. His presence is felt by disturbing telephone calls, his voice an unsettling presence, and his actions are a violation of the secure area of the sorority home.
The Christmas setting, with its festive decorations and vacation gatherings, is reworked right into a looking floor. Using the phone, usually adorned with holiday-themed gadgets, amplifies the sensation of dread because the killer’s calls turn out to be more and more menacing. Garland’s actions characterize a violation of the sanctity of dwelling and the innocence related to the vacation.
- The Gremlins (Gremlins, 1984): The Gremlins, whereas not a single villain, characterize a collective menace that emerges when the foundations surrounding the Mogwai, Gizmo, are damaged. Their motivation is chaotic, fueled by a want for destruction and mayhem. Their look transforms from cute and cuddly to monstrous and harmful, reflecting the implications of irresponsible actions. They make the most of the Christmas setting, turning the decorations and festive lights into weapons.
They devour Christmas treats and use holiday-themed gadgets as instruments of destruction. They’re a metaphor for unchecked indulgence and the risks of ignoring warnings, mirroring the surplus of the vacation season. The chaos they unleash straight contrasts with the vacation’s beliefs of peace and goodwill.

- Uncommon Exports: A Christmas Story (2010) : This Finnish movie reimagines the legend of Santa Claus as a monstrous, historical being. A bunch of males in a distant space of Finland unearth the true Santa Claus, a terrifying determine who punishes naughty kids in a really literal sense. The movie’s mix of darkish humor, gorgeous visuals, and folklore makes it a really distinctive entry within the style.
It gives a contemporary tackle the origins of Santa Claus.
- Anna and the Apocalypse (2017) : This British musical-zombie-horror movie follows a gaggle of youngsters as they battle zombies throughout a Christmas-themed apocalypse. The movie’s catchy musical numbers, mixed with the gory zombie motion, create a surprisingly efficient and entertaining expertise. It makes use of musical numbers to lighten the temper of the horror.
- Christmas Evil (1980) : This movie facilities on a person named Harry Stadling, who’s obsessive about Christmas and, after a traumatic childhood, turns into a killer who punishes these he deems “naughty.” The movie is a darkish and disturbing take a look at the psychological impression of childhood trauma and societal pressures. The movie’s reasonable portrayal of psychological sickness is unsettling.
- Higher Watch Out (2016) : This dwelling invasion thriller initially presents itself as a typical Christmas film a few babysitter and the youngsters she cares for. Nevertheless, the movie rapidly takes a darkish flip, revealing the true nature of one of many kids. It’s a subversion of the harmless kids trope.
- All of the Creatures Have been Stirring (2018) : This anthology movie presents a collection of interconnected tales that happen throughout a Christmas Eve get-together. The movie explores themes of loneliness, consumerism, and the darker aspect of relationships. It’s a trendy tackle the anthology format.
- A Christmas Horror Story (2015) : This Canadian anthology movie weaves collectively a number of interconnected tales, together with Krampus, a zombie outbreak, and Santa Claus battling a monstrous menace. It supplies a complete exploration of various Christmas horror tropes.

- Black Christmas (1974): The movie masterfully makes use of the unseen presence of the killer to generate concern. The frequent use of point-of-view pictures from the killer’s perspective, mixed together with his heavy respiratory on the telephone calls, creates a palpable sense of dread. The sound design is essential; the creaking of the attic door, the hushed whispers, and the unsettling silence earlier than a kill all contribute to the suspense.
The cinematography emphasizes the isolation of the sorority home and the vulnerability of the characters.
- Silent Night time, Lethal Night time (1984): The movie leverages the iconography of Santa Claus to create a disturbing distinction. The leap scares are sometimes triggered by the killer, dressed as Santa, showing unexpectedly. The movie makes use of a mix of sound and visible parts to create these scares. The sound of sleigh bells morphing right into a menacing chime, the killer’s heavy footsteps, and the sudden look of his face are all designed to shock the viewers.
- Krampus (2015): This movie successfully makes use of a mix of creature design, sound design, and sensible results to create unsettling scenes. The leap scares are sometimes preceded by a build-up of suspense, with the sound of Krampus’s minions, such because the gingerbread males or the demonic toys, rising louder and nearer. The movie makes use of a mix of sensible results and CGI to create the monsters, making them seem each grotesque and terrifying.
Using shadows and darkness additional enhances the suspense.
